Reasons to consider the Intel Pentium E6600
- CPU is newer: launch date 1 year(s) 5 month(s) later
- Around 15% higher clock speed: 3.06 GHz vs 2.67 GHz
- Around 4% higher maximum core temperature: 74.1°C vs 71.4°C
- Around 46% lower typical power consumption: 65 Watt vs 95 Watt
- Around 7% better performance in PassMark - Single thread mark: 1220 vs 1139
- Around 4% better performance in Geekbench 4 - Single Core: 392 vs 376

Reasons to consider the Intel Core 2 Quad Q9400
- 2 more cores, run more applications at once: 4 vs 2
- 2x more L1 cache, more data can be stored in the L1 cache for quick access later
- 3x more L2 cache, more data can be stored in the L2 cache for quick access later
- Around 84% better performance in PassMark - CPU mark: 2150 vs 1168
- Around 73% better performance in Geekbench 4 - Multi-Core: 1151 vs 666
